Shallot: how much to plant.

A family of 4 eating shallot a few times a week needs about 5 plants in ~3 sq ft, worth about $4 a year at the store. Here are the exact numbers for your household, and when to plant in every zone.

How much to plant

Plants, space, seeds, and value.

Counts assume about 3 servings per person per week with a germination buffer built in. Store value uses ~$2.00/lb retail — an estimate that varies by region and season.

HouseholdPlantsBed spaceSeeds to buyStore value / yr
1 person2~1 sq ft~4~$2
2 people3~2 sq ft~6~$2
4 people5~3 sq ft~9~$4
6 people7~4 sq ft~13~$6

Spacing

6" in row · 12" between rows

Sow depth

1"

Days to harvest

100 from seed

When to plant

Sow windows by USDA zone, 2026.

Zone dates are typical, not exact. The free planner uses your ZIP code's frost dates, not just the zone, and shifts every window to match.

ZoneSpring sow windowFall sow window
Zone 3Mar 20 – Apr 24Aug 25 – Sep 29
Zone 4Mar 15 – Apr 19Sep 4 – Oct 9
Zone 5Mar 5 – Apr 9Sep 14 – Oct 19
Zone 6Feb 23 – Mar 30Sep 24 – Oct 29
Zone 7Feb 8 – Mar 15Oct 4 – Nov 8
Zone 8Jan 28 – Mar 4Oct 25 – Nov 29
Zone 9Jan 1 – Jan 30Nov 14 – Dec 19
Zone 10Jan 1 – Jan 10Nov 24 – Dec 29

Know before you grow

The practical stuff.

Yield

About 0.4 lbs per plant over ~1 productive weeks (~0.4 lb).

Watch for

Onion thrips · Onion maggot · Downy mildew — the pest guide covers organic fixes for each, and Pest Radar shows what gardeners near you are reporting right now.

Neighbors

Plays well with carrot, beet, tomato-slicing, lettuce-leaf. Keep away from pole-bean, bush-bean, snap-pea.

On the plate (per 100 g, USDA)

72 kcal · 3.2 g fiber · 8 mg vitamin C · 334 mg potassium
